Video shows devastation: Germans missing after landslide in Italy

Severe storms have caused major flooding and landslides in northern Italy, especially in Brazzano di Cormons. Two people remain missing, while emergency services continue to work in a number of affected locations.

Street flooding and major damage in Italy. Since Sunday, extremely powerful storms have caused chaos in northern and central Italy. In a very short period of time, rainfall reached 200 liters per square meter in some places, causing widespread flooding, mudslides and mudslides.

One person was injured, two people are still missing

Brazzano di Cormons in the north of the country was worst hit. Landslides destroyed residential buildings there. Emergency services were able to rescue one person alive from the wreckage; he was taken to hospital in Udine with a broken leg.

Two people remain missing – a man in his mid-30s and an older woman. According to the Governor of Gorizia, the man became trapped in the water while trying to help the woman who was stuck in the mud.

About 200 emergency calls

Three buildings were completely buried under rubble and others were badly damaged. The Udine fire brigade continued to operate and recorded around 200 emergency calls during the night. In many other cities in Italy, many streets were under water.

Although authorities issued early warnings, the force of the storm caused severe damage in many places. The search for missing people continues.
